Default amber color headunits

i asked this question a while ago, but now im getting one for reals and just seeing if theres anything new: what decent headunits are there that have amber coloring for a more oem look? i dont use an ipod, bluetooth, or any of that crap, just want a decent sounding cd player.

I know Eclipse HU's have an amber color scheme available (multiple color selections). Not sure about Pioneer and Alpine. When I had Alpine (years ago), the only available colors were blue and green (amber was used, but not an available main scheme).

I recommend either the Eclipse CD3200 or Eclipse CD5030.

Looks like the CD5030 only has blue or red illumination. I would look at local stores to see if any have CD3200's in stock still. You might be able to find a CD8454 or CD3100 (older models) which also have amber illumination.
